Definition

The British Pound (GBP) is one of the world’s major fiat currencies, while the Lebanese Pound (LBP) represents the currency of Lebanon. The exchange rate between them reflects market dynamics and currency valuation in the foreign exchange market.

Today’s Price

  • 1 GBP = 118,890.28 LBP (as of March 28, 2026)
  • 24h High: 119,681.56 LBP
  • 24h Low: 116,704.85 LBP
